#3 Giroud makes his case for the London derby

Giroud has scored 3 goals in 2 games

Arsenal’s woes in November have been a hallmark of the past few seasons and they seemed intent on sticking to that script. Lately, though, this Arsenal side has shown a more resilient character and the summer signings of Xhaka and Mustafi have played their part in solidifying the team.

However, on Tuesday night, when the team was named, Giroud was the focal point of the attack. Although the Frenchman scored two goals with his first two touches at the weekend, there have been still doubts about his fitness.

Instead, Giroud showed Arsenal they have a different dimension to their game. With a testing run of fixtures to come in the month of November, the Frenchman again made his case with a superbly taken goal.

Injuries and suspensions may have restricted his appearances this season but his lethal finishing and overall teamwork is an asset that Wenger admires. While Sanchez does offer a lot of mobility upfront, Giroud’s hold up play brings the other midfielders into play.

Giroud will hope that his current form of 3 goals in 2 games will give Arsene Wenger a thing or two to think about.
